Replacement handle
A window handle is an essential part of any double-glazed residence. It offers security against intruders and helps you save energy costs by keeping the sash shut. Over time the uPVC handle can become damaged or worn. You'll need to replace it. Luckily, replacing your window handle is an easy job that you can complete yourself.
The first thing you have to do is take off the screws at the lower part of the window handle. You can use a screwdriver do this. Once the screws are removed, the handle and lock assembly can be accessed. Once the assembly has been disassembled, the handle and lock can be replaced. Once the assembly has been replaced, you can put the screw caps back on.
Typically the replacement handles come with everything you need to put it on. However, some manufacturers offer an additional seal to ensure a watertight fit. This seal should be applied prior to installing the handle to avoid any leakage. It is also important to select the correct size for the new handle. Usually, cockspur handles have lug centers of 31mm, while tilt and turn handles have 43mm centres (2 fixings).

Replacement cover plate
It's time to replace your window handle if the one you have broken or is no longer functioning. It can be done in a couple of easy steps, and you will only need a screwdriver to finish the job. The first thing to do is determine the reason for the handle to fall off or stopped working. This will help you determine what part is in need of replacement.
Once you have bought the new handle, you will have to ensure it's the correct size for your window. Based on the manufacturer of your window, it can be difficult to find an exact match. However, most replacement handles are standard size and are compatible with your uPVC windows.
The first step is to detach the screws that hold the handle to the window mechanism. This will reveal two screw holes. You can use a screwdriver to unscrew these screws, but take care not to scratch the window frame or handle.
You should also make note of the length of the spindle, which is usually a square peg sticking out from the handle's bottom. This will need to be the same size as the spindle in your new handle. You can use a tape measure determine the length of the spindle if don't know its length.
The next step is to remove the casement cover and gain access to the crank's innards. This can be done by removing the trim mounting screws on the casement frame. After removing the screws, slide a rigid putty blade between the window jamb and casement cover, and carefully pry up the casing. After the crank is removed, you can install a new operator.
It is important to ensure that the handle moves effortlessly and smoothly in both locked and unlocked positions. Then you can screw the new screw into place and replace screw covers. Once the handle is secure then you can test it to ensure that it is working correctly. If it does not then you can tighten the screws once more or try another one.
Screws to replace window glass near me
A damaged screw could stop the window from opening or closing. You can purchase a new screw to reattach the handle to the shaft of your window. To ensure the optimal operation of a casement or an awning it is crucial that the handle of the operator be firmly attached. The screws that are replaced can be resized to fit the hole in the handle to prevent the need to drill a new hole. The screws are made from stainless steel, which prevents corrosion.
Resize screws can be used to fix broken or missing set screw in the handle. If you have a damaged screw that has become stuck in the handle, try heating it gently using a hair dryer to soften it up so it can be removed with the pliers or junior hacksaw.
